Virtual Communication
Virtual communication is transforming the way organizations handle their phone systems. With the shift towards remote work and global collaboration, businesses are gradually adopting cloud solutions that offer flexibility and scalability. By using internet-based platforms, companies can now host their telephone systems in the cloud, allowing for greater accessibility and reduced dependence on traditional hardware.
One of the primary advantages of cloud-based telephone systems is the economic benefit they provide. Organizations can remove the need for costly on-premises equipment, as cloud solutions often function on a subscription model. This approach not just lowers upfront investments but also reduces ongoing maintenance expenses. As businesses look for strategies to optimize their operational costs, cloud-based communication arises as a practical choice.
Additionally, cloud communication systems enable effortless integration with other digital tools and applications. This connectivity boosts productivity by allowing users to connect to their telephone systems alongside email, instant messaging, and customer relationship management (CRM) software. As the lines between different communication channels merge, cloud-based solutions are becoming vital for businesses aiming to streamline their workflows and enhance customer service.
AI in Telephony
Artificial Intelligence is revolutionizing telecommunication systems by improving the way businesses manage communication. AI-powered tools, such as virtual assistants, are optimizing customer interactions, enabling companies to provide support continuously. These intelligent systems can handle a variety of tasks, from handling typical queries to managing calls more effectively, thereby minimizing wait times and enhancing customer satisfaction.
Additionally, artificial intelligence technologies are being integrated into telephone systems to analyze conversations in real-time. This enables businesses to gain valuable insights into customer behavior and preferences, enabling them to tailor their services accordingly. Integrated communication solutions signify a significant evolution in the way businesses oversee their phone systems. By integrating voice, video, messaging, and collaboration tools into a single platform, organizations can streamline their conversational processes. This integration not just improves the experience of users but also promotes better cooperation among team members, regardless of their physical location.
The positives of unified communication systems go beyond just convenience. They often offer additional features such as availability statuses, allowing employees to see the status of their peers in the moment. This can produce faster response times and improved efficiency, as employees can easily link up through their most liked communication method. Furthermore, the merging of multiple applications into a single solution reduces the need to toggle between multiple applications, thus making it easier for employees to remain organized and focused on their work.
As businesses continue to embrace remote and hybrid work models, the requirement for robust and flexible phone systems has increased. These solutions respond to this demand by offering solutions that are scalable and responsive to various business environments.
